Join our team at M&S as a Customer Assistant in Operations, you’ll be the backstage powerhouse of our stores. It’s a physically demanding, high-intensity role that keeps our stores running like clockwork. If you’re ready to roll your sleeves up and work smart, this is the role for you.
You’ll be responsible for stock, deliveries, and all the vital behind-the-scenes work that ensures our shop floor stays full, clean, and ready for our customers to shop. There’s no room for delay. You’ll be fast, focused, and always one step ahead, keeping the flow of products moving with urgency and accuracy.
Flexibility is vital. You’ll work across the wider store where needed – always keeping up with the pace and demands of retail.
Being digitally confident is essential. You’ll use digital tools confidently to track deliveries and manage stock efficiently, always focused on availability and speed.
Being a team player is essential. You’ll be a key cog in a big machine, working across functions and supporting colleagues across the store.
Flexibility is vital. From early morning deliveries to shifting stock late into the day, you’ll adapt quickly to keep things moving.

Here’s what to expect at each stage of the application process. This can change depending on the role you’ve applied to. If you need any reasonable adjustments made at any stage, let us know and we can help.
Fill in our short application form and hit submit.
We’ll invite you to take part in an online assessment. This could be before or after your interview.
We’ll invite you to an in-person assessment centre or an interview. This process may differ depending on the role you’ve applied to.
After we’ve decided, we’ll be in touch. If you’ve been successful, we’ll officially invite you to join the team and let you know the next steps.
